🦠 Yellow Fever in Monrovia

Monrovia currently carries a HIGH risk level with a score of 68/100, reflecting active transmission potential and significant environmental drivers. This score accounts for the city's tropical climate, dense urban population, and proximity to forested endemic zones where the virus circulates between non-human primates and mosquitoes. The primary vector, Aedes aegypti, thrives in Monrovia's urban environment, breeding in water containers, discarded tires, and clogged drainage systems throughout the city.

The risk score of 68 specifically reflects several converging factors: incomplete vaccination coverage among the local population, seasonal rainfall patterns creating abundant breeding sites, and limited vector control infrastructure. Monrovia's position on the Atlantic coast at 6°18′N latitude places it within the yellow fever belt of West Africa, where the virus has historically caused devastating outbreaks. The city's rapid, unplanned urbanization has created ideal conditions for Aedes mosquito proliferation, with standing water accumulating in construction sites, markets, and residential areas.

Current seasonal factors driving transmission include the May–October rainy season, which dramatically increases mosquito breeding habitat. During this period, humidity levels exceed 80% and temperatures range 24–30°C, creating optimal conditions for viral replication within mosquitoes. The inter-epidemic period following the 2017–2018 regional outbreak has left population immunity gaps, while cross-border movement from rural endemic areas in Nimba, Bong, and Lofa counties continuously reintroduces the virus.

🛡️ Prevention Steps

  1. Get vaccinated at least 10 days before arrival — The yellow fever vaccine is the single most effective prevention measure. Obtain vaccination at an authorized center and carry the International Certificate of Vaccination (yellow card). Monrovia's Roberts International Airport may request proof of vaccination upon entry.

  2. Apply DEET-based repellent consistently — Use 20–30% DEET or picaridin formulations on exposed skin every 4–6 hours. Reapply after sweating or rain exposure. Focus application during dawn and dusk when Aedes mosquitoes are most active, though daytime biting occurs throughout Monrovia.

  3. Wear permethrin-treated clothing — Treat shirts, pants, and socks with permethrin spray before travel. This provides additional protection even after washing. Light-colored, loose-fitting clothing reduces mosquito attraction and bite success.

  4. Eliminate standing water around your accommodation — Inspect and empty water containers, flower pots, tires, and clogged gutters at your Monrovia lodging. Focus on Waterside, Sinkor, and Paynesville neighborhoods where breeding sites are abundant.

  5. Sleep under insecticide-treated bed nets — Use long-lasting insecticidal nets (LLINs) even in urban settings. Ensure nets are properly tucked and without holes. This provides protection during peak biting hours.

  6. Avoid outdoor activities during peak biting hoursAedes mosquitoes bite primarily during daylight hours, with peaks at dawn and dusk. Limit outdoor exposure during these times, especially near markets and water bodies.

  7. Use spatial repellents indoors — Deploy metofluthrin emanators or coil repellents in enclosed spaces. Ensure rooms have screened windows and doors or use air conditioning when available.

  8. Seek immediate medical attention if symptoms develop — Do not self-medicate with aspirin or NSAIDs, which worsen bleeding complications. Early presentation to medical facilities improves outcomes significantly.

🏥 Symptoms & When to Seek Help

Early Symptoms

  • Fever (3–6 days post-infection): Sudden onset of high fever, often 39–40°C
  • Headache: Severe, generalized headache with retro-orbital pain
  • Myalgia: Prominent muscle pain, especially back and leg pain
  • Nausea and vomiting: Gastrointestinal symptoms common in first 24–48 hours
  • Fatigue and dizziness: Profound weakness and lightheadedness
  • Relative bradycardia: Faget's sign — pulse slower than expected for fever height

Seek Immediate Medical Care If...

  • Jaundice develops (yellowing of skin/eyes) — indicates hepatic involvement
  • Bleeding from gums, nose, or in vomit/stool — sign of hemorrhagic phase
  • Confusion or altered consciousness — suggests neurological involvement
  • Decreased urine output — indicates renal failure
  • Seizures or severe abdominal pain

⚠️ CRITICAL: The toxic phase of yellow fever has a 20–50% mortality rate. Patients deteriorate rapidly after apparent improvement. Do not delay seeking care at John F. Kennedy Medical Center or Redemption Hospital in Monrovia. Inform clinicians of travel history and vaccination status.

💊 Treatment & Local Medical Resources

No specific antiviral treatment exists for yellow fever. Management is supportive care: fluid resuscitation, blood product transfusion for hemorrhage, and renal replacement therapy when indicated. Ribavirin has shown in vitro activity but clinical efficacy remains unproven.

Vaccination provides lifelong immunity in 99% of recipients. The 17D vaccine is safe and effective, with rare serious adverse events. Monrovia's healthcare infrastructure faces significant challenges: limited ICU capacity, intermittent supply chain disruptions, and workforce shortages. The Expanded Programme on Immunization has improved coverage but gaps persist.

Travelers should carry comprehensive medical evacuation insurance and identify air ambulance services before arrival. The WHO Country Office and CDC Liberia can provide updated facility recommendations. Private clinics in Sinkor may offer more consistent services than public facilities.
